What?
See #76034 (comment)
The Icon Library page is a bit unique compared to other stories. It allows us to filter icons, and this filtering is synchronized with the URL. This filter doesn't seem to work in Docs. Disabling
autodocsis probably the easiest solution.Testing Instructions
